So, 'Adam & Henry Adventures' has this really casual vibe – it’s like you’re right there with them, feeling the wind in your hair as they pedal through various landscapes. The documentary aspect gives it a grounded feel, capturing those raw moments that scripted films often gloss over. You can sense the camaraderie between the filmmaker and his friends, which adds a nice layer to the adventure. The pacing feels organic; it flows with their journey rather than forcing a narrative. The humor is pretty laid-back, too – nothing over the top, but it’s clever in how it highlights the absurdities of traveling. There’s a real charm in its simplicity, you know? Just a couple of guys finding their way, both literally and figuratively.
